08 Nov. 2016 – A new achievement has been added to the Lebanese records at the World Kung Fu-Wushu Championship, with Georges Eid and Bachir Yamin grabbing medals for our NT.
First, Eid was able to defeat Italy’s Dominico Stable in the semis before losing against China’s Gao Fang Fo in the final and thus getting a silver medal in the 80 KG. This great result comes right after Georges’ gold medal in the Sanda style at the world championship.
Secondly, Bachir Yamin got a bronze medal in the 75 KG category, by losing in the second stage against Aymad Mohamad from Egypt.
